A1 is Premier League

A1 Flue Systems is in the Premier League of flue companies after installing systems at the stadiums of some of English football’s top-flight clubs this season.

We have installed systems at Wolverhampton Wanderers, Burnley and Huddersfield Town – all of whom play in the Premier League – in the last few months.

And our work also extends north of the border, having completed a project for Heart of Midlothian, who play in the Scottish Premiership.

Our Director John Hamnett said it’s rather fitting that A1 – which is the market leader in the manufacture, installation and maintenance of commercial and industrial chimney, flue and exhaust systems and has won lots of ‘titles’ of its own – is the company that leading football clubs turn to for new flues.

“A1 is in good company working on projects for Premier League and Scottish Premiership clubs this season – after all, we’re a multi-award-winning company ourselves, scooping our industry’s most-prestigious prizes,” said John. 

For a business of our size and expertise, all the projects have been very straightforward, but each one is definitely a feather in our cap and adds to a bulging portfolio of prestigious projects that we have worked on.

Our reach has extended beyond football: we have also recently completed projects at Epsom Downs Racecourse (the venue of the world-famous Derby flat race) and Headingly, which hosts test matches and is the home to Yorkshire County Cricket Club.

We have also in the past completed projects for Arsenal Football Club’s Emirates Stadium, Twickenham (the home of English rugby) and Cardiff’s Principality Stadium.
